Cards Can’t Complete Comeback, Fall To Bellarmine 67-66

The Knights of Bellarmine wanted nothing more than to spoil the first game of the Kenny Payne
era and walk out of the Yum! Center with a win, and they did just that.

The Cards were slow out of the gate and Bellarmine took full advantage outscoring them 41-30
in the first half. Defensive breakdowns allowed the Knights to lead by as much as twelve in
the first half and completely dominated in the paint despite Louisville’s size advantage. The
Knights shot an impressive 59% from the field to the Cards’ 38% heading into the break where
one can only imagine what Payne had to say to his guys.
